Mobile medical units and field hospitals
Mobile medical units and field hospitals are vital components of the Italian Military Medical Services, designed to provide immediate and effective healthcare during deployments and emergencies. These units are equipped to operate independently in diverse environments, ensuring medical support reaches personnel in remote or conflict zones.
Typically, mobile medical units include ambulances, portable clinics, and specialized teams capable of rapid deployment. Field hospitals are more comprehensive, featuring operating rooms, diagnostic laboratories, and inpatient wards, allowing for complex medical procedures. These facilities are constructed for quick setup and dismantling, allowing flexibility in various operational scenarios.
The Italian Military Medical Services continuously update these units with advanced medical equipment and technology. This ensures rapid response capabilities and high standards of medical care in challenging conditions. Their adaptability enhances Italy’s ability to support international missions and civilian disaster relief efforts effectively.

Medical Procedures and Emergency Response Capabilities
The Italian Military Medical Services are equipped with comprehensive medical procedures designed for rapid response to emergencies. These procedures ensure prompt stabilization and care for injured personnel during missions or on military bases.
Emergency response capabilities are optimized through specialized training, simulating combat and disaster scenarios. Medical personnel are trained to operate advanced field equipment swiftly, ensuring efficient triage, resuscitation, and evacuation procedures.
Integration of these capabilities allows Italy to effectively handle diverse crisis situations. Specialized protocols are in place for mass casualties, chemical, biological, radiological, and nuclear incidents, reflecting a high level of preparedness within the Italian Military Medical Services.
Italy’s Military Medical Collaboration and International Missions
Italy’s military medical services actively participate in international collaborations and missions to contribute to global health support and humanitarian efforts. These initiatives enhance Italy’s diplomatic relations and strengthen their medical capabilities in diverse contexts.
Italy collaborates with NATO, the European Union, and United Nations agencies, providing medical assistance during peacekeeping and disaster relief operations. Their deployment often includes mobile medical units, field hospitals, and medical teams, ensuring rapid response capabilities.
Key aspects of Italy’s international medical efforts include:
- Deploying medical personnel in conflict zones or disaster-affected regions.
- Offering training and expertise to partner nations’ military and civilian medical teams.
- Participating in joint exercises to improve operational readiness and interoperability.
Such collaboration not only demonstrates Italy’s commitment to international stability but also allows for knowledge exchange and technological advancements within their military medical services.
